Sasuchan hosts 2nd Partner Conference + a career fair
Last week, Sasuchan Development Corporation hosted our Partner Conference & Career Fair in Prince George, bringing together partners, industry proponents, community contractors, staff, and Takla Nation members for two days focused on relationship-building, information-sharing, and future opportunities.
We would like to extend our sincere appreciation to everyone who attended, participated, presented, and supported this event.
Day 1 focused on partner and industry engagement through project updates, presentations, networking, and meaningful discussions surrounding current and upcoming work occurring within Takla Traditional Territory.

Day 2 welcomed Takla Nation members and students to participate in the Career Fair, where attendees had the opportunity to connect directly with companies and industry representatives to learn more about career pathways, workforce opportunities, and the skills, training, and education required to enter different industries.
